Turkey & Dressing PieThis pie is a clever and very tasty way to deal with holiday leftovers.
Combine the dressing with the butter, mixing well. Press on bottom and sides of a 9-inch pie pan or quiche dish. Bake for 7 minutes, and allow to cool. (Lower oven heat to 325°F before baking pie.) Combine the turkey and cheese, and spread in cooled pastry shell. Combine the eggs, salt and half-and-half, beating well, and pour over the turkey mixture.
